7007157: (pack200) stripping attributes causes a NPE Reviewed-by: jrose, mduigou, dholmes

+/*
+ * @test
+ * @bug 7007157
+ * @summary make sure the strip command works on an attribute
+ * @compile -XDignore.symbol.file Utils.java T7007157.java
+ * @run main T7007157
+ * @author ksrini
+ */
+public class T7007157 {
+
+    public static void main(String... args) throws IOException {
+        File sdkHome = Utils.JavaSDK;
+        File testJar = new File(new File(sdkHome, "lib"), "tools.jar");
+        JarFile jarFile = new JarFile(testJar);
+        File packFile = new File("foo.pack");
+        Pack200.Packer packer = Pack200.newPacker();
+        Map<String, String> p = packer.properties();
+        // Take the time optimization vs. space
+        p.put(packer.EFFORT, "1");  // CAUTION: do not use 0.
+        // Make the memory consumption as effective as possible
+        p.put(packer.SEGMENT_LIMIT, "10000");
+        // ignore all JAR deflation requests to save time
+        p.put(packer.DEFLATE_HINT, packer.FALSE);
+        // save the file ordering of the original JAR
+        p.put(packer.KEEP_FILE_ORDER, packer.TRUE);
+        // strip the StackMapTables
+        p.put(packer.CODE_ATTRIBUTE_PFX + "StackMapTable", packer.STRIP);
+        FileOutputStream fos = null;
+        try {
+            // Write out to a jtreg scratch area
+            fos = new FileOutputStream(packFile);
+            // Call the packer
+            packer.pack(jarFile, fos);
+        } finally {
+            Utils.close(fos);
+            Utils.close(jarFile);
+        }
+    }
+}
